Understanding the Types of Wheel Mould Damage
Before discussing the repair of wheel moulds, it is essential to understand the different types of damage that can occur. Common forms of damage include wear and tear, cracks, corrosion, and surface defects.
Wear and tear is a gradual process that occurs due to the repeated use of the mould. During the injection - molding process, the molten plastic rubs against the mould surface, causing the surface to gradually erode. Over time, this can lead to dimensional inaccuracies in the produced wheels.
Cracks can develop in wheel moulds for several reasons. High - pressure injection, thermal stress, and mechanical impacts are common causes. Cracks can be particularly problematic as they can propagate, leading to further damage and potentially rendering the mould unusable.
Corrosion is another significant issue, especially for moulds used in environments where they are exposed to moisture or corrosive substances. Corrosion can weaken the mould structure and affect the surface finish of the produced wheels.
Surface defects, such as scratches and pits, can also occur. These can be caused by improper handling, cleaning, or the presence of foreign particles in the moulding process. Surface defects can result in cosmetic flaws on the wheels, reducing their overall quality.
The Feasibility of Repairing Wheel Moulds
The answer to whether a damaged wheel mould can be repaired is often yes, but it depends on several factors. The extent and type of damage are the primary considerations. Minor wear and tear, small surface defects, and some types of corrosion can usually be repaired. However, extensive cracks, severe corrosion, or significant structural damage may make repair unfeasible.
For minor wear and tear, the mould can often be refurbished by machining or polishing the surface. This process can restore the dimensional accuracy of the mould and improve the surface finish. For example, if the surface of the mould has become rough due to wear, a precision machining operation can be performed to remove the damaged layer and create a smooth surface.
Surface defects like scratches and pits can sometimes be repaired by filling them with a suitable material and then polishing the area. This can restore the integrity of the mould surface and prevent further damage.
Cracks are a more challenging issue. In some cases, small cracks can be repaired by welding. However, this requires careful consideration as welding can introduce new stresses into the mould. If the crack is too large or located in a critical area of the mould, repair may not be possible, and the mould may need to be replaced.
Repair Methods for Wheel Moulds
Machining and Polishing
As mentioned earlier, machining and polishing are common methods for repairing wheel moulds with wear and tear or surface defects. Machining involves removing a thin layer of the mould surface using precision tools. This can correct dimensional inaccuracies and improve the surface finish. After machining, the mould is polished to achieve a smooth surface, which is essential for producing high - quality wheels.
Welding
Welding is a method used to repair cracks in wheel moulds. However, it must be carried out by experienced professionals. The type of welding used depends on the material of the mould. For example, for steel moulds, TIG (Tungsten Inert Gas) welding is often used as it provides precise control and produces high - quality welds. Before welding, the crack must be properly prepared by cleaning and beveling the edges. After welding, the area needs to be heat - treated to relieve stress and prevent further cracking.
Coating
Coating can be used to protect the mould surface and repair minor corrosion. There are various types of coatings available, such as hard chrome plating, nickel - based coatings, and ceramic coatings. These coatings can improve the hardness, wear resistance, and corrosion resistance of the mould surface. For example, hard chrome plating can provide a smooth and durable surface that reduces friction and wear during the moulding process.
Considerations When Repairing Wheel Moulds
When deciding whether to repair a damaged wheel mould, several factors need to be considered.
Cost - effectiveness
Repairing a wheel mould can be a cost - effective solution compared to replacing it, especially for minor damage. However, in some cases, the cost of repair may be close to or even higher than the cost of a new mould. This is particularly true for moulds with extensive damage. A cost - benefit analysis should be conducted to determine the most economical option.
Time
Repairing a wheel mould can take time, especially if complex procedures such as welding or heat - treatment are involved. This can cause production delays. If the production schedule is tight, it may be more practical to replace the mould rather than repair it.
Quality
The quality of the repair is crucial. A poorly repaired mould may not produce wheels of the desired quality. It is essential to choose a reliable repair service provider with experience in wheel mould repair. They should have the necessary equipment and expertise to ensure that the repaired mould meets the required specifications.
